Difference Between a C-Corp and S-Corp

While there are other differences, the main difference between a C-Corp and S-Corp is whose income gets taxed. Unlike the S-Corp, the C-Corp pays taxes on their income at the business entity level. The S-Corp, on the other hand, pass their tax burden on to shareholders.
